Lemon Syrup
Lemon syrup is a thick, sweet liquid with a pronounced lemon flavor, made from lemon juice, sugar, and water. It is used as the base for homemade lemonades, cocktails, and mixed drinks, or as a flavoring in teas and fruit beverages. In confectionery, it is added to creams, fillings, ice creams, and sorbets. It is also used to soak cake sponges to keep them moist. The syrup can be easily made at home or purchased ready-made. Commercial versions may contain colorings and flavorings, while homemade versions tend to be purer and more intense in flavor. Store in the fridge where it keeps for several weeks. It pairs wonderfully with pancakes, waffles, and fruit salads.
